NXTM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2016 in Review

170 of the 4,000 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in NxStage Medical Inc. (NXTM) for Q4 2016, worth a combined $1.61B — up 0.36% from $1.6B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 33 funds opened new NXTM positions and 17 closed out — a net gain of 16 holders — while 45 added to existing stakes and 72 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Pennant Capital Management, adding an estimated $37.8M. The largest seller was Fidelity Investments, cutting an estimated $47.6M.
